The Wedding Party Grand Premiere: An Experience Worth Reliving

By R&B PR ace

The much talked about Dubai Tourism Grand Premiere of ‘The Wedding Party’, held on the 26th of November 2016 at the Eko Hotel and Suites, Victoria Island, Lagos. The highly anticipated and most sought-after invitation of 2016 had a ‘White and Chic’ dress code which saw cast and guests alike step out elegantly to the flashes and clicks of cameras.

The sold-out evening left guests reeling with excitement starting in the Bridal Court where guests were welcomed with signature Baileys cocktails whilst posing for pictures. The train then moved to the Gourmet Board where a 3- course dinner was served. Hosted by Bovi and Mimi Onalaja, the dinner had lots in store for the VIP guests including live performances by Seyi Shay, Isaac Gerald, Ruby Gyang and Timi Dakolo and raffle draws anchored by Headline Sponsor, Dubai Tourism. Some of the night’s standout prizes include luxury accommodation courtesy Arabian Falcon, theme park passes courtesy IMG Worlds of Adventure; helicopter rides courtesy Alpha Tours Helicopter Rides and other VVIP gifts.

After dinner, guests were moved into a custom built theatre for the movie screening. The full capacity audience laughed from start to end. After screening, Director Kemi Adetiba introduced her cast and crew led by Executive Producers, Mo Abudu (EbonyLife TV); Kene Mkparu (FilmOne); Naz Onuzo (InkBlot) and Laura Jeyibo (Koga Studios). The screening also broke the record for the largest mannequin challenge in Nigeria with an entire theatre posing in tribute to the social media phenomenon.

The highlight of the evening was the Premiere After-Party held in The Honeymoon Bay with DJ Obi on the decks. Guests savoured delicious treats by Hans N Rene and themed cocktails from the Baileys, Ciroc and Johnnie Walker. It was a befitting climax to what had been an awe-inspiring evening.
